Book Description

Jun 9 2009 Elephant & Piggie Books
Gerald is careful. Piggie is not.
Piggie cannot help smiling. Gerald can.
Gerald worries so that Piggie does not have to.

Gerald and Piggie are best friends.
In Elephants Cannot Dance! Piggie tries to teach Gerald some new moves. But will Gerald teach Piggie something even more important?

About the Author

#1 New York Times best-selling author and illustrator Mo Willems started his career on Sesame Street, where he garnered six Emmy Awards for his writing before changing the face of children's literature with his groundbreaking picture books. Mo has been awarded a Caldecott Honor on three occasions (for Don't Let the Pigeon Drive the Bus!, Knuffle Bunny: A Cautionary Tale, and Knuffle Bunny Too: A Case of Mistaken Identity) and his acclaimed Elephant and Piggie early reader series received the Theodor Seuss Geisel Medal in 2008. He lives in Western Massachusetts

There aren't many easy reader series out there that are as funny as the Elephant and Piggy books. These have very simple illustrations and a lot of very emotional turns of phrase, so hopefully you can start from the beginning keeping kids from developing that awful droning readaloud voice so many children have.

The trouble in this book is that no matter what Piggy does to teach Gerald how to dance, he cannot - it says so in the book of what elephants can do. Eventually he gets frustrated and throws a tantrum... which is quickly adopted by the local squirrels as "the Elephant dance". Guess Elephants can dance after all :)

Best moment? Has to be when Piggy says "Jump when I say three" and Gerald is a full two pages behind the beat.

Mo Willems is a wonderful author for children. He captures the concerns of children in nuanced and humorous text, and the illustrations are just incredibly beguiling. His new book, "Elephants Cannot Dance" is another winner.

Gerald is convinced that "elephants cannot dance" but Piggie responds, "You are kidding me." Gerald says, "Look it up" and hands Piggie a book detailing "What Elephants Can Do". I don't want to give away any more of the delightful repartee. Read it and enjoy!

Creating easy readers that adults can enjoy reading must be extremely difficult. Mo Willems creates them superbly.
